Different
than traditional conceptions of religions, Dr.
Royal observes the concepts that Jesus expressed.
He never taught people what they should believe,
but rather taught them that their beliefs caused
them to experience the physical equivalents of
them. This conception about reality is a
Principle, because it can be proven that our
attitudes about life cause us to live as we do.
We have to change our thinking to upgrade our
experiences. Jesus' greatness lay in the fact
that he demonstrated this conception (or
Principle) every time he met someone who
earnestly desired to have some condition or
circumstance removed and replaced with its
positive opposite. Therefore, the blind were able
to see, the lame were able to walk, and the
discouraged were able to live with a new
enthusiasm. Examples of
what Jesus actually taught come to us through
words that he spoke to persons who experienced
through his consciousness. An example is one that
he said to the Roman centurion which is veriously
interpreted by bibical translators. For instance,
in the Revised Standard Version, Matthew 8:13,
"Jesus said, 'Go be it done for you as you
have believed.' " The centurion's servent
who was extremely ill a long distance away was
instantly made completely well. What happened was
that the centurion's belief was already there,
and the fact that Jesus endorsed it was all that
remained necessary for the healing to take place.
One chapter later, Matthew 9:22, "He said,
'Take heart, my daughter; your faith has made you
well.' " This is a women who suffered from a
hemorrhage for 12 years and touching "the
fringe of His garnment" she was instantly
healed. Note that he said "your faith."
This indicates that she believed that she would
be well, and Jesus 'consciousness' enabled her to
believe.
Jesus
was teaching that their beliefs were all that was
necessary. They came to Him thinking that He was
essential for the healings to take place, but
once he explained that it was their beliefs that
caused the healings, He had explained a principle
which after several years of teaching had become
fairly well grasped by His disciples.

Within the thoughts of most
people who have benefited from Spiritual
Teachings is a tendency to agree about three
beliefs in particular. One of them is that
whatever anyone believes is all right for him or
her to practice insofar as it does not harm
anyone, including the one practicing it. In
accordance with that, it is beneficial to believe
that everything happens in our lives through the
thoughts, beliefs, and opinions we have. Should
we change any of them that are negative in
relationship to an impending crisis or when a
disappointing happening occurs, we thereby
maximize the possibility of healing.
The second belief is that the
universe and every person, creature, plant,
element, and everything else is whole, perfect,
and complete. But you may say that you cannot
understand this conception when you definitely
know that wars, poverty, disease, and natural
disasters regularly occur. The answer is that all
of those catastrophes happen, but they are
appearances that match the thinking of people who
experience them. We can rise above all
calamities. This teaching shows how this can be
done. It includes that we practice living by a
spiritual philosophy that is a thing of thought,
especially of right ideas.
The third belief is this: God
is all there is! There is no place that God is
not. Despite God's being all, the occurences of
poverty, disease, and other experiences of harm
cover up the Presence of God and the Truth of
God's beingness. Every harmful expeience is the
result of our mistaken beliefs. Beneath all harm
is God's Presence. As we believe that God is
perfect and that God's perfection is always good,
healing takes place. Through our practicing this
kind of believing, God and God's Truth is
revealed. The revelation of God's perfection is
possible for any person who believes that God is
all there is. To acquire this belief, we have to
free our thoughts from accepting that harm needs
to continue in our lives.
